西门子/SIEMENS 品牌
经销商厂商性质
上海市所在地
西门子6SE7041-8EK85-1HA0
SIEMENS西门子上海朕锌电气设备有限公司
:钟涛(小钟)
24小时销售及:
电 话:
手 机: :
:
:
地址:上海市金山区枫湾路500号
公司主营:西门子数控系统,S7-200PLC S7-300PLC S7-400PLC S7-1200PLC 6ES5 ET200 人机界面,变频器,DP总线,MM420 变频器MM430 变频器MM440 6SE70交流工程调速变频器6RA70直流调速装置 SITOP电源,电线电缆,数控备件,伺服电机等工控产品。: :
描述
在 SIMATIC 范围内,对于三大产品系列:SIMATIC S7、SIMATIC S5 和 PC,都支持时间同步。可以通过以太网、P ROFIBUS 和 MPI 进行时间同步。该 FAQ 描述了一个通过 PROFIBUS 进行时间同步的实例。
下面的表格给出了哪些 PROFIBUS-CP 可以用于使用 PROFIBUS 进行时间同步:
模块 | 订货号 |
CP443-5 基本型 | 从订货号6GK7443-5FX01-0XE0 FW V3.0开始 |
CP443-5 基本型 | 6GK7443-5FX02-0XE0 |
CP443-5 扩展型 | 从订货号6GK7443-5DX02-0XE0 FW V3.0开始 |
CP443-5 扩展型 | 6GK7443-5DX03-0XE0 |
CP443-5 扩展型 | 6GK7443-5DX04-0XE0 |
CP443-5 扩展型 | 6GK7443-5DX05-0XE0 |
CP5613 (FO/A2) | 6GK1561-3AA00 6GK1561-3AA01 6GK1561-3FA00 |
CP5614 (FO/A2) | 6GK1561-4AA00 6GK1561-4AA01 6GK1561-4FA00 |
CP5623 | 6GK1562-3AA00 |
CP5624 | 6GK1562-4AA00 |
表 01
从一定的固件版本开始下面的 CPU 可以通过集成的 DP 接口实现时间同步。
模块 | 订货号 | 固件版本 |
CPU 31x | 6ES7 31.. | V2.5 |
CPU 41x | 6ES7 41.. | V3.0 |
IM154-8 CPU | 6ES7154-8AB00-0AB0 | V2.5 |
IM154-8 PN/DP CPU | 6ES7154-8AB01-0AB0 | V3.2 |
IM154-8F PN/DP CPU | 6ES7154-8FB01-0AB0 | V3.2 |
IM154-8FX PN/DP CPU | 6ES7154-8FX00-0AB0 | V3.2 |
表 02
下面带有 CPU 的接口模块通过 DP 主站接口模块 6ES7138-4HA00-0AB0 实现时间同步。
模块 | 订货号 | 固件版本 |
IM151-7 CPU | 6ES7151-7AA20-0AB0 | V2.6 |
IM151-7 F CPU | 6ES7151-7FA20-0AB0 | V2.6 |
IM151-8 PN/DP CPU | 6ES7151-8AB00-0AB0 | V2.7 |
IM151-8 PN/DP CPU | 6ES7151-8AB01-0AB0 | V3.2 |
IM151-8F PN/DP CPU | 6ES7151-8FB00-0AB0 | V2.7 |
IM151-8F PN/DP CPU | 6ES7151-8FB01-0AB0 | V3.2 |
表 03
通过 PROFIBUS 执行时间同步
图. 01
下面部分包括以下操作指导:
1. S7-400 站作为时间主站(传输方)的配置
2. S7-400 站作为时间从站(接收方)的配置
3. 具有时间同步功能的 PC 的配置
在硬件组态中组态 S7-400 站的时间同步。在 CPU 属性窗口中选择 "诊断/时钟"选项卡 ,然后选择同步模式。可以组态 S7-400 CPU 作为时间主站( 时间传输方) 或时间从站(时间接收方)。
设置是在 CPU 中同步(在 PLC 同步)还是通过 MPI 同步(在 MPI 同步)。在 PLC 中的同步包括CP。
可以在 1 秒和 24 小时之间选择同步的时间间隔。
S7-400 作为时间主站(传输方)的配置
下面是配置 S7-400 站作为时间主站的操作。
序号 | 操作 |
1. | 在 S7-400 站的硬件组态中,打开 CPU 的属性窗口,选择“诊断/时钟”选项卡。 在 PLC 的同步模式中设置“作为主站”,并且选择同步的时间间隔,例如 10 秒。 点击“确定”关闭窗口。
|
2. | 在硬件组态中参数化 S7-400 的 PROFIBUS CP 进行时间传递。 打开 PROFIBUS CP 的属性窗口,切换到“选项”选项卡,参数化传递时间消息的方向。如果 S7-400 站是作为时间主站,使能传递时间消息的方向:
来自 CPU 的时间消息通过 PROFIBUS CP 传递到 PROFIBUS 子网上。
|
表 04
S7-400 站作为时间从站(接收方)的配置
下面是配置 S7-400 站作为时间从站的操作。
序号. | 操作 |
1. | 在 S7-400站的硬件组态中,打开CPU的属性窗口,选择“诊断/时钟”选项卡。 在PLC的同步模式中设置为“作为从站”。 点击“确定”关闭窗口。
|
2. | 在硬件组态中参数化 S7-400 的 PROFIBUS CP 进行时间传递。 打开 PROFIBUS CP 的属性窗口,切换到“选项”选项卡,参数化传递时间消息的方向。如果 S7-400 站是作为时间主站,使能传递时间消息的方向:
来自 PROFIBUS 子网的时间消息会被 PROFIBUS CP 接收,并传递到 CPU。
|
表 05
西门子6SE7041-8EK85-1HA0
注意
时间同步可确保zui大偏差为 10 毫秒的网络范围的精度。
PC 站时间同步的配置
CP5613 (FO/A2), CP5614 (FO/A2), CP5623 和 CP5624 可用于 PC 的时间同步。通过 SIMATIC NET PC V6.0(CD 07/2001)及以上版本,CP5613 (FO) 和 CP5614 (FO) 可用 NCM PC 组态。在PC 站的硬件组态中,打开 PROFIBUS PC CP 的属性窗口,切换到“选项”选项卡,使能 "Time of day" 功能,可以组态 PROFIBUS PC CP 作为时间主站(传输方)或者是时间从站(接收方)。
图. 06
PC 不能自动发送和接收时间。必须使用应用程序实现,程序通过函数调用写或从 CP 读取时间
1. 设置调制解调器波特率
使用调制解调器的电缆将远程调制解调器 TC65T 连接到计算机的串口上。使用菜单命令 “Start > All Programs> Accessories > Communications >HyperTerminal”。
序号 | 标注 |
1 | 按“Cancel”键忽略“Connection Description”的名称分配。 |
2 | 使用“File -> Properties”打开连接属性。在 “Connect using”栏选择需要连接的调制解调器的通信端口。通过“Configure...”打开连接配置,在 “Bits per second:”栏选择使用的波特率然后点击“OK”键。 注意:
|
3 | 在连接属性窗口选择“Settings”标签并打开“ASCII Setup”窗口,通过选择“Echo typed characters locally”激活命令输出并点击“OK”键确认,点击“OK”键退出连接属性窗口。
|
4 | 通过“Call” 键建立与调制解调器的连接。可以使用 “AT”指令检查波特率的设置,如果成功,调制解调器返回“OK”作为响应。 注意: 使用“Disconnect”键中断连接。
|
表 01
2. 设置 CPU 通信口波特率
改变 CPU 连接到调制解调器的通信接口波特率如下。
序号 | 标注 |
1 | 检查 PC/PPI 电缆的 DIP 开关。DIP 开关的 5 脚必须设置到“1”(电缆为 PPI 多主站模式)。 注意: 1 2 3 4 5 6 7 8 这时可以用电缆将 CPU 和电脑相关的通信口连接起来。 |
2 | 打开 STEP 7-Micro/WIN 切换到“Set PG/PC Interface”界面。在“Interface Parameter Assignment Used:”选项中选择“PC/PPI cable (PPI)” ,点击“Properties...”按钮,在“Local Connection”标签中选择PC机使用的通信接口。切换到“PPI”标签选择“Advanced PPI”复选框按两次“OK”键确认。
|
3 | 切换到“Communications”界面。检查“Search all baud rates” 复选框并选择“Double-click to Refresh”。搜索 CPU 的波特率,当发现时显示CPU的地址和连接端口的波特率。标注CPU并按“OK”确认,传输发现的波特率作为“Properties - PC/PPI cable(PPI)”窗口中设置的传输速率并完成与CPU的通信设置。如果发现的波特率与调制解调器波特率相匹配(9.6 kbit/s)CPU与调制解调器的通信被激活 。
|
4 | 如果发现的波特率与调制解调器波特率不匹配(9.6 kbit/s -> 参考表 01),切换到“System Block”界面并选择“Communication Ports”标签,设置使用的通信端口为 9.6 kbit/s 并按“OK”键确认。
|
5 | 通过相应的按钮将配置下载到 CPU 中。现在 CPU 使用的端口和“Properties - PC/PPI cable(PPI) ”(见表.04)的波特率被设置到调制解调器 9.6 kbit/s 传输速率。如果重复步骤3,可以搜索到定义的传输速率 9.6 bit/s 。
6SE7041-8EK85-1HA0 |
表 02
3. 为远程调制解调器设置 PC/PPI 电缆:
使用“PC/PPI Multi-master cable”,通过如下步骤把远程调制解调器里的 SIM 卡的 PIN 码转移。
序号 | 标注 |
1 | 检查 PC/PPI 电缆的 DIP 开关。(见表02,*步)。 |
2 | 打开 STEP 7-Micro/WIN 切换到“Set PG/PC Interface”界面。在“Interface Parameter Assignment Used:”选项中选择“PC/PPI cable (PPI)” ,点击“Properties...”按钮,在“Local Connection”标签中选择“Modem connection”复选框并选择PC机使用的通信接口。切换到“PPI”标签,设置传输速率为“9.6 kbit/s” ,按“OK”键确认。
|
3 | 通过菜单"Tools"打开 “Modem Expansion Wizard”。然后选择“Configure an analog modem, cellular modem, or PPI Multi-master cable”选项并点击“Next”键。
|
4 | 在“Modem Configurations”配置中选择"PPI Multi-master Cable" 并点击"Modem Commands...".按钮在新打开的窗口中“Mode”选择“Multi-master”,在 “Cell Phone Authorization”进入指令“AT+CPIN=1234”(“1234”表示SIM卡的PIN码),点击“OK”键确认。
|
5 | 点击“Program/Test”发送程序到 PC/PPI 电缆,完成之后可以看到“Successfully configured in Multi-Master mode on COM1。”信息在"Port Status"域显示("COM1"表示正在使用的PC通信端口)。 点击 "Finish"键完成 "Modem Expansion Wizard"的配置并点击"OK"键确认。
|
6 | 为了使PC/PPI电缆作为 S7-200 与远程调制解调器 TC65T 的连接电缆,必须设置 DIP 开关6脚为1 (“1=Remote / DTE”)。 1 2 3 4 5 6 7 8 现在连接 PC/PPI 到TC65T的“PC - RS232 ”端。 注意: |
7 | 如果打开 TC65T 电源,PC/PPI 电缆供电(通过连接 PC/PPI 电缆到CPU),经过大约 30 秒的初始化,PIN 码传输到 TC65T 中。 注意: |
表 03
4. 设置拨号服务
警告:
建立从模拟网络到 GSM 调制解调器(例如 TC65T) 的拨号服务,必须激活 SIM 卡的数据通信业务,电信通常将分配一个单独的号码(数据业务号码)。
现在通过模拟的调制解调器连接 PC/laptop 通信端口到网络。
序号 | 注释 |
1 | 在“Start > Settings > Control Panel”窗口打开“Phone and modem options”对话框。在“Modem”标签选择模拟调制解调器并点击"Properties"键。在“Modem”标签设置扬声器为收听。设置zui大的端口速度为“9600”,决定在拨号前是否选择拨号音等待。 注意: 点击“OK”键确认两次。
|
2 | 参考表 3 的步骤 2 传送 PG/PC 的接口设置。 在“Local Connection”界面选择连接模拟调制解调器的通信端口。 |
3 | 打开“Communications"”界面,双击黄色闪烁的符号表设置连接数据。在“Modem Connection”窗口点击“Settings...”。
|
4 | 在“Modem Connection Settings” 对话框点击“Add...”按钮打开“Add Modem Connection Wizard”,进入连接的名称,选择本地的调制解调器,然后点击“Next >”。
|
5 | 在 “Phone Number to Dial” 窗口进入远程调制解调器的数据号码()。 在 “Transmission Settings”窗口点击 “Next >”设置本地调制解调器终止时间。这里可以使用缺省设置。然后点击“Next >”显示设置的概貌。点击“Finish”关闭窗口。
|
6 | 点击“Close”返回“Modem Connection”对话框,设置连接的终止时间至少 90 秒然后点击“Connect”开始拨号服务 。
|
7 | 如果连接成功建立,窗口自动关闭。切换到"Communications"界面,双击“Double-Click to Refresh” 显示远程PLC的地址。标注控制器并且点击 “OK”键,现在 CPU 可以进行拨号服务了。 注意:
|
8 | 清除拨号服务必须再次打开“Communications”界面,双击黄色闪亮的符号,Modem Connection”窗口打开,点击“Disconnect”清除拨号服务。
|